Job description

The Estée Lauder Companies Inc. is one of the world’s leading manufacturers, marketers, and sellers of quality skin care, makeup, fragrance, and hair care products, and is a steward of luxury and prestige brands globally. The company’s products are sold in approximately 150 countries and territories under brand names including: Estée Lauder, Aramis, Clinique, Lab Series, Origins, M·A·C, La Mer, Bobbi Brown Cosmetics, Aveda, Jo Malone London, Bumble and bumble, Darphin Paris, TOM FORD, Smashbox, AERIN Beauty, Le Labo, Editions de Parfums Frédéric Malle, GLAMGLOW, KILIAN PARIS, Too Faced, Dr.Jart+, the DECIEM family of brands, including The Ordinary and NIOD, and BALMAIN Beauty.

Description

Conducts all inspections and documentation to ensure Quality specifications are met on a timely basis.

Accountabilities: (Tasks listed below may vary depending upon assigned location)

  • Assists Supervisor with assigning employees to work stations.
  • Inspect and audit orders for accuracy, content and specifications utilizing systems where appropriate.
  • Provides a quality standard for presser/packers or assemblers to use as a guideline for product quality.
  • Assist supervisor with random audits. Documents results.
  • Evaluates process/product through required inspections to ensure conformity to standardized process specifications and quality standards. Documents results.
  • Determines acceptability of product and/or process with respect to company standards and specifications and notifies supervisor of any quality manufacturing problems found during audits.
  • Assists supervisor in Root Cause analysis of Quality/Accuracy issues and recommends corrective action. May assist with any recommended re⁃training.
  • Performs a variety of clerical functions including filing, record keeping and maintenance of reports. Inputs information into computer system.
  • Assists with periodic verification of flow racks for accuracy (lot trace, qty, manufacturing issues).
  • Verify line clearance process is followed.
  • Assist QA with verification regarding expired product in the flow racks.
  • Follows all safety and good manufacturing practices (GMP's).
  • Performs various other duties as assigned including assisting with the training of new employees.
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alent or related experience.
  • Good communication skills and demonstrated knowledge of English, reading and writing. Basic knowledge of arithmetic.
  • For Distribution, minimum of one⁃year Quality Coordinator or Distribution experience preferred.
  • For Manufacturing, minimum of one⁃year Production experience preferred.
  • Must be able to lift 25 pounds.
  • Must demonstrate leadership ability.
  • Ability to navigate in computer systems such as Word, Excel, Outlook, Internet & Intranet.
  • Must successfully pass written and practical tests and achieve scores equivalent to national standards.
  • Must be able to work overtime as needed, including weekends.
  • Must be available to work all shifts.
  • Must be available to work in all Northtec facilities as needed.
  • May require a criminal background check.
  • Equipment Used Calculator, personal computer and quality manufacturing equipment.
Pay Range

Anticipated Base Salary Range $20.00 to $24.00 (Depending on qualifications, skills, experience and/or budget), based on a 40 hour work week (range to be scaled accordingly).
